Provides support in a 24x7x365 Network Operations Center that monitors, resolves, tests, and escalates Network DAS and Small Cell issues to ensure company compliance with customer requirements.Essential Job Functions
- Serve as primary support for Small Cell Operations by managing internal and customer devices, performing analysis of alarms, and taking steps to restore service.
- Engage field operations and Tier 2 support for network equipment issues as needed.
- Respond to client requests and notify clients of network problems and business impacts.
- Review planned and unplanned changes to network infrastructure.
- Surveil and monitor the DAS & Small Cell networks by using provided systems and tools to remotely access complex equipment and resolve alarms on these networks.
- Use provided tools to localize network problems to host or remote equipment.
- Recognize correlation of multiple alarm conditions or tickets to identify root cause and possible resolution.
- Provide and monitor internal communication with Fiber NOC on alarm status and resolutions.
- Provide and monitor external communication with customers of the SCN NOC on alarm statuses and providing updates on escalations.
- Interface with field personnel to verify repairs, testing of alarm systems and documenting resolutions.
- Basic configuration & troubleshooting of DAS network alarms.
- Provide first contact for large scale outages and provide feedback on outages for customers, contractors, technicians, and other involved employees.
- Maintain a working knowledge of all products, processes, and systems associated with the various systems utilized in the SCN NOC.
